Hey guys new here. I apologize if this is answered I have been searching and can’t find anything in this. I have a NV3550 from a 1997 k1500 had a 5.7 vortec in it. I recently bought a 5.3 l59.

my question is can I use the flywheel from the 5.7 and bolt it to my 5.3 with the same clutch plate or do I need to buy a new flywheel and pressure plate and clutch?

I have seen mixed answers. Some say it will bolt right up some say it won’t.

thank you in advance for your help. I’m throwing this in my 97 jeep tj

People who say it'll bolt right up don't know Engines. Gen III LS Engines are a whole different Crank Flange bolt pattern than the Gen I & II SBC.

You'll need a Clutch kit for what you're trying to do.
